About 6-(3,4-dimethoxyphenyl)-3-pyridin-2-yl-[1,2,4]triazolo[3,4-b][1,3,4]thiadiazole
6-(3,4-dimethoxyphenyl)-3-pyridin-2-yl-[1,2,4]triazolo[3,4-b][1,3,4]thiadiazole (PubChem CID 662931) has the molecular formula C16H13N5O2S
and a molecular weight of 339.38 g/mol. Its IUPAC name is 6-(3,4-dimethoxyphenyl)-3-pyridin-2-yl-[1,2,4]triazolo[3,4-b][1,3,4]thiadiazole.

What is the SMILES notation for 6-(3,4-dimethoxyphenyl)-3-pyridin-2-yl-[1,2,4]triazolo[3,4-b][1,3,4]thiadiazole?
The canonical SMILES for 6-(3,4-dimethoxyphenyl)-3-pyridin-2-yl-[1,2,4]triazolo[3,4-b][1,3,4]thiadiazole is COc1ccc(-c2nn3c(-c4ccccn4)nnc3s2)cc1OC.
What is the InChIKey of 6-(3,4-dimethoxyphenyl)-3-pyridin-2-yl-[1,2,4]triazolo[3,4-b][1,3,4]thiadiazole?
The InChIKey is MEWRLQUBVOVSGN-UHFFFAOYSA-N. The full InChI is InChI=1S/C16H13N5O2S/c1-22-12-7-6-10(9-13(12)23-2)15-20-21-14(18-19-16(21)24-15)11-5-3-4-8-17-11/h3-9H,1-2H3.
What are the key properties of 6-(3,4-dimethoxyphenyl)-3-pyridin-2-yl-[1,2,4]triazolo[3,4-b][1,3,4]thiadiazole?
6-(3,4-dimethoxyphenyl)-3-pyridin-2-yl-[1,2,4]triazolo[3,4-b][1,3,4]thiadiazole has a molecular weight of 339.38 g/mol, XLogP of 2.93, 4 rotatable bonds, 0 hydrogen bond donors, and 8 hydrogen bond acceptors.
